

Oracle VM VirtualBox and DxEnterprise compete in virtualized environments. Oracle VM VirtualBox excels in affordability, while DxEnterprise offers advanced features for a higher price, appealing to enterprise-level database management.
Features: Oracle VM VirtualBox offers cross-platform support, integration capabilities, and compatibility with a wide range of hosts and guest operating systems. DxEnterprise focuses on high availability, multi-platform database virtualization, and dynamic failover capabilities, designed for enterprise-level database management.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service:Oracle VM VirtualBox supports a simple deployment process with ample community resources for support. DxEnterprise adopts a professional support model and tailored deployment, providing thorough assistance for complex environments where expertise and substantial support are crucial.
Pricing and ROI: Oracle VM VirtualBox is cost-effective with high ROI due to low setup costs. DxEnterprise requires a higher initial investment but offers long-term value through its advanced feature set for enterprise database needs.

Oracle VM VirtualBox is a cost-free, user-friendly virtual machine platform that supports multiple operating systems and offers features like snapshots and seamless file sharing while allowing the execution of diverse environments on one machine.
Guests on Oracle VM VirtualBox benefit from its ease of setup, support for multiple OS, and advanced features like cloning and Remote Desktop Protocol access. Its compatibility with formats such as VMware and QEMU enhances its adaptability. However, users suggest enhancements in networking capabilities, remote accessibility options, and cross-platform operation support. While the interface is simple, improvements are desirable for better file management between host and virtual machines. Despite identified performance limitations, it remains a stable and flexible choice for running concurrent environments on a single system.
What core features enhance its usability?Oracle VM VirtualBox is widely implemented in testing environments, software development, and educational contexts. It aids in quality assurance, server virtualization, and cross-platform deployment across Windows, Linux, and Solaris.
